Barred Tiger Salamander

The Barred Tiger Salamander (Ambystoma mavortium) is a species in the genus Ambystoma. It is currently classified as Least Concern on the IUCN Red List. Typically found in freshwater habitats, moist forests, and wetlands.

Clouded Agaric

The clouded agaric (Clitocybe nebularis, syn. Lepista nebularis) is a large, robust saprotrophic mushroom in the family Tricholomataceae found across temperate broadleaved and mixed forests of Europe and North America. It produces pale grey to buff fruiting bodies with broad, wavy caps up to 20 cm diameter, crowded, slightly decurrent gills, and a stout stipe, typically emerging in large fairy rings or scattered groups in autumn woodland settings. The common name 'clouded' refers to the greyish, misty coloration of the cap surface. Though historically eaten in parts of Europe and considered edible when thoroughly cooked, C. nebularis is now known to contain toxic compounds and a heat-labile gastrointestinal toxin that causes illness in some individuals, and it is associated with documented poisoning cases. Its strong mealy odor is distinctive. The species is widespread and common across European deciduous forests, fruiting reliably in autumn and forming an important component of the saprotrophic fungal community responsible for decomposing accumulated leaf litter and organic matter in temperate forest ecosystems.
